English cricket great Freddie Flintoff has faced off against himself in a reflective short film from Natwest.

2019 Freddie Flintoff faces a 2005 Flintoff machine in Natwest cricket spot
The bank, which has supported the sport for 38 years, set up a specially modified bowling machine to replicate the Lancastrian's deliveries during his greatest ever over in the 2005 Ashes victory at Edgbaston. Then it put modern-day Flintoff on the crease to see how he would fare against himself.
In the five minute film, footage of Flintoff batting against his own almost unplayable bowling is intercut with poignant clips of the star recalling one of his most memorable moments in the sport.
Created by M&C Saatchi, the spot sees the 41-year-old harken back to past glories and its release coincides with today's England team dominating Australia again to secure a place in Sunday's World Cup final.
